Javascript
I am a Full Stack Developer with a solid grounding in various programming languages and a commitment to adapting to new technologies. My experience includes:
Collaborative Projects: Contributed to cross-platform MVPs using Ionic with React, valuing teamwork and iterative development.
Data Migration: Participated in the migration of hydrocarbon production data, enhancing my knowledge of PL/SQL and Oracle databases.
Versatile Development: Engaged in both front-end and back-end development of a hydrocarbon data management application, utilizing Django, HTML, CSS, JavaScript, and Python.
User-Centric Design: Focused on creating websites with an emphasis on user experience and service communication.
Client Support: Dedicated to providing thorough support and addressing client needs to meet their operational requirements.
Sector Contribution: Supported essential hydrocarbon accounting operations, financial verification, and data reporting, contributing to informed decision-making and regulatory adherence.
I am passionate about using my skills to deliver quality solutions and enjoy the challenge of solving complex problems.
In my role as a Business Consultant Trainee at Cegal, I support the company’s mission to drive digital transformation in the energy sector. My contributions include:
- Client Support: I assist in the day-to-day support of the hydrocarbon accounting solutions Cegal offers, ensuring clients’ data is managed effectively.
- Financial Verification: I help verify Japex invoices, focusing on accuracy to facilitate smooth financial operations.
- Data Reporting: I contribute to the preparation of the Rhum Management Company (RMC) reports, which are vital for informed decision-making and compliance.
- Technical Skills: I am honing my SQL skills to better analyze and interpret hydrocarbon data, which is essential for the industry’s operational processes.
- Operational Insight: I am developing an understanding of how to align technical systems with business needs for improved hydrocarbon management.
- Process Assurance: I support the testing and documentation processes to maintain the integrity and reliability of our accounting systems.
Cegal provides an ideal environment for my professional growth. As a trainee, I am learning from industry experts and contributing to projects that enhance Cegal’s offerings in the energy sector.
As a front-end developer, I have played a key role in the development of Metis, an in-house hydrocarbon production data management and accounting solution built with Django. In addition to my front-end expertise, I have also gained a strong understanding of Django's backend.
In addition to my work on Metis, I have also been responsible for mapping and migrating twenty years of data from two legacy systems into EnergyBuilder, a hydrocarbon production and accounting management software. This required me to have a thorough understanding of both systems and the data they contained, as well as strong problem-solving skills to ensure a smooth transition of data.
I have also designed and developed a new, modern website for GSES using ReactJs. This project required me to have a solid foundation in front-end development, as well as an eye for design and user experience.
In my previous role, I have been involved in fast-paced agile development, with a focus on creating and maintaining databases, serverless functions, and connecting services via APIs using AWS. I have also developed a high-fidelity front-end application in React using the Ionic framework.
In addition to these responsibilities, I have also redefined the application for native use on both Android and iOS using React Native. To ensure smooth and efficient releases, I also aided in the developmenht of a continuous integration/continuous deployment (CI/CD) pipeline that guides the software through its lifecycle before final release.
Through my experience with agile methodologies, I have become well-versed in the processes used to facilitate fast, flexible development. This includes daily stand-ups with the development team, refining the backlog of tasks, planning sprints with task duration estimations, and conducting bi-weekly sprint reviews with the entire team to assess progress and refine tasks as needed.
During a five-week contract, I developed a responsive web application in React that provided clear guidance for digital delivery projects in the RAF and beyond. Adopting a strict agile approach, I worked closely with the client to incorporate their feedback and deliver a high-quality product that met their needs.
One of the key requirements for this project was to ensure that the application was WCAG2.1 compliant, as well as adhering to the principles outlined in the Ministry of Defence design system. This required a strong attention to detail and a commitment to creating a user-friendly and accessible application.
Overall, I was able to successfully complete this project within the given timeline by focusing on speed and flexibility.
Javascript
HTML5
CSS3
PL/SQL
Python
Django Framework
Reactjs
Java
Bash
Languages:
Frameworks:
Databases / Backend Tools:
Project Management Tools:
Design Tools:
Other Skills: